摘要: 在培养创新型人才过程中,学科竞赛作为创新能力和实践能力人才培养的重要载体,一方面,有效地激发了大学生的创新思维与创新能力,另一方面,也在发展中存在不少问题。该文分析了学科竞赛对创新型人才培养的现状,从培养体系、创新实践基地建设、导师队伍建设、学科竞赛常态化及学生团队梯度培养等方面,探索了材料类本科生注重专业学习和持续培养的培养模式,为其在学科竞赛中的创新能力培养提供借鉴。

Abstract: In the process of cultivating innovative talents, subject competition, as an important carrier of cultivating innovative and practical talents, on the one hand effectively stimulates college students' innovative thinking and innovative ability, on the other hand, there are many problems in the development. This paper analyzes the current situation of the training of innovative talents by subject competition, and explores the training mode of material undergraduate focusing on professional learning and continuous training from the aspects of training system, construction of innovation practice base, construction of tutor team, normalization of subject competition and gradient training of student team, so as to provide reference for the cultivation of innovative ability in subject competition.
